Recent Seminar: Epistemology and the Bible
Saturday 15 March | 9:30am-1pm | Location: Tyndale House, Cambridge (CB3 9BA) | with Dr Esther Lightcap Meek and Dr Dru Johnson
- How do we know anything at all?
- How do our default ways of knowing relate to our knowledge of Scripture?
- Can knowledge be relational? How do covenants help us understand how knowledge works?
- What role does love play in our process of knowing?

Dr Esther Lightcap Meek
Dr Esther Lightcap Meek is Professor of Philosophy emeritus at Geneva College, Western Pennsylvania. She is an Associate Fellow with the Kirby Laing Centre for Public Theology, and a member of the Polanyi Society. She is the author of several books, including Longing to Know: The Philosophy of Knowledge for Ordinary People, Loving to Know: Covenant Epistemology, and Doorway to Artistry: Attuning Your Philosophy to Enhance Your Creativity.

Dr Dru Johnson
Dr Dru Johnson is the Templeton senior research fellow at Wycliffe Hall (University of Oxford), adjunct professor of religion at Hope College in Holland, Michigan, and director of the Center for Hebraic Thought. He is the author of numerous books, including Biblical Knowing: A Scriptural Epistemology of Error, Biblical Philosophy: A Hebraic Approach to the Old and New Testaments, and soon to be published, Understanding Biblical Law: Skills for Thinking With and Through Torah.

Seminar chaired by Dr Tony Watkins
Dr Tony Watkins is the Fellow for Public Engagement at Tyndale House. He has been a speaker and writer on the Bible and media for many years, and his PhD explored ideas of flourishing in biblical prophetic literature and narratives in today's media.
